Laubach Castle

Laubach Castle is a renaissance- style castle in Laubach , a suburb of Abtsgmünd in the Ostalb district .

history

In 1439 a castle in Laubach built by Konrad von Woellwarth (died after 1463), which he had received from his father Georg IV von Woellwarth-Leinroden, was mentioned. The line founded by Konrad von Woellwarth-Laubach with its headquarters in Laubach Castle died out with Hans Bartholomäus von Woellwarth-Laubach in 1572. The castle was then divided between the Lords of Notthracht and the Lords of Bernhausen . In 1586 the Notthracht sold their share for 6000 guilders to Hans Sigmund von Woellwarth-Fachsenfeld, who also bought half of the Lords of Bernhausen towards the end of the 16th century. In 1599 he had a new castle built, a four-wing Renaissance building with four towers with bell domes. In 1870, the Woellwarth-Laubach family died out in the male line with the death of Karl Reinhard Freiherr von Woellwarth-Laubach . After negotiations between the Württemberg feudal council and Wilhelm Freiherr von Woellwarth-Lauterburg, the castle was assigned to Woellwarth-Lauterburg in 1871, who carried out structural measures for renovation and the creation of a terrace or earthfill in the following years. In their possession, however, the castle only served as a summer residence. In 1983 the castle, which had been in need of renovation over the years, was bought by six private individuals.
